Eartha Kitt's "Uskudar" - a Turkish folksong from the 18th century. She probably got it from a recording by Zeki Muren which had been popular in Turkey a few years before.

I have heard the same tune with Greek words on a collection of field recordings from Crete. The tune doesn't sound either very Greek or very Turkish to me, it wouldn't surprise me if it were originally Egyptian or Palestinian.

A more recent one - "Gallows Pole" by, um, Robert Plant? A version of Macpherson's Farewell. And from the 1990s, wasn't GRiD's "Swamp Thing" based on a real old-time banjo tune?
